Embrace the Serenity of the Apostle Islands
Nestled along the shores of Lake Superior, the Apostle Islands National Lakeshore offers a truly unique camping experience. Explore the 21 islands, each with its own distinct charm and breathtaking views. Campers can enjoy hiking, kayaking, fishing, and simply soaking up the beauty of this natural wonder.
Immerse Yourself in the Northwoods at Chequamegon-Nicolet National Forest
Spanning over 800,000 acres, Chequamegon-Nicolet National Forest is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ts. Discover a multitude of tent campgrounds, each offering a taste of the untamed wilderness. Hike through ancient forests, paddle on crystal-clear lakes, and marvel at the diversity of flora and fauna.
Unwind Amidst the Beauty of the Kettle Moraine
The Kettle Moraine State Forest, located in southeastern Wisconsin, boasts a diverse landscape of rolling hills, glacial lakes, and dense forests. Campers can explore miles of hiking trails, go for a refreshing swim, or simply relax by the campfire under the starry sky.
Choosing the Perfect Tent Campground for Your Needs
Selecting the ideal tent campground depends on your preferences and the type of experience you seek. Here are some factors to consider when making your decision:
Determine Your Desired Level of Convenience
Some campgrounds offer modern amenities such as flush toilets, hot showers, and electrical hookups. Others embrace a more rustic experience, relying on vault toilets and communal water spigots. Choose the level of convenience that aligns with your camping style.
Consider the Campground Activities
Campgrounds often offer various activities, from swimming and fishing to hiking and biking. Think about the activities that interest you and choose a campground that caters to them.
Evaluate the Campground Size and Atmosphere
Large campgrounds with bustling activity may not be suitable for those seeking solitude. Smaller, more secluded campgrounds provide a sense of tranquility and privacy.
Wisconsin’s Tent Camping Gems: A Detailed Look
Let’s delve into some of the most highly rated and popular tent campgrounds throughout Wisconsin. Each campground offers its unique charm and caters to different interests.
North Star Campground – Hayward, WI
Situated in the heart of the Northwoods, North Star Campground provides a tranquil escape from the hustle of everyday life. This campground, known for its clean facilities and friendly staff, is an ideal choice for family vacations and group gatherings.
Devil’s Lake State Park – Baraboo, WI
Devil’s Lake State Park is a beloved destination for outdoor enthusiasts, boasting a stunning landscape, a plethora of hiking trails, and a campground that accommodates both tent and RV campers. The campground offers a range of amenities, including restrooms, drinking water, and picnic tables.
Governor Dodge State Park – Dodgeville, WI
Nestled amidst rolling hills and dense forests, Governor Dodge State Park offers a diverse range of camping options, including tent campsites, RV sites, and even a unique yurt village. The campground is especially popular for its scenic hiking trails and opportunities for horseback riding.
Big Bay State Park – Iron River, WI
Big Bay State Park is a nature lover’s paradise, with a picturesque shoreline, pristine lake, and abundant wildlife. The campground offers a rustic experience, featuring vault toilets, communal water spigots, and a magnificent view of Lake Superior.
Mirror Lake State Park – Barron, WI
Mirror Lake State Park offers a serene setting for tent camping, with its serene lake, wooded trails, and a variety of amenities. The campground is well-maintained and provides a perfect balance of relaxation and outdoor recreation.
Frequently Asked Questions about Tent Camping in Wisconsin
What are the best times to go tent camping in Wisconsin?
The best time to go tent camping in Wisconsin depends on your preferences. Spring and fall offer mild temperatures, vibrant foliage, and fewer crowds. Summer provides warm weather for swimming and boating, but you may encounter more visitors.
What are some essential camping gear items for a tent camping trip in Wisconsin?
Essential camping gear includes a tent, sleeping bag, sleeping pad, campfire grill, headlamps, first-aid kit, insect repellent, sunscreen, and plenty of water.
What are some safety tips for tent camping in Wisconsin?
Always let someone know your camping plans and expected return time. Be aware of your surroundings, especially when hiking or exploring. Store food and other attractants properly to prevent wildlife encounters.
